Description
Tim Webb reports from Cheltenham on the announcement of black candidate John Taylor as the Conservative’s PPC. Cheltenham’s Conservative Party Chair, Monica Drinkwater, announces the result of the vote; Taylor gives a victory speech; Nick Leach(?) (one of the so-called Cheltenham Eight) and Bob Williams (who also opposed Taylor’s selection) play down the racial factor and promise their support; retiring Conservative MP, Sir Charles Irving welcomes his successor.
